Symptoms of a bad or leaking valve cover gasket the most common symptoms of a bad valve cover gasket are external oil leaks and a low engine oil level when you check the dipstick You may also notice a burning smell after acceleration In some cars, it can also result in a misfiring engine or a check engine light Here is a more detailed list of the signs of a bad or leaking valve cover gasket.
